GUS-QS0B-02-4020-DD Description
GUS-QS0B-02-4020-DD Description
The GUS-QS0B-02-4020-DD from TT Electronics/IRC is a high-precision thin-film resistor network designed for demanding surface-mount applications. This 20-pin QSOP package integrates 19 resistors, each with a 402Ω resistance value and an ultra-tight ±0.5% tolerance, ensuring exceptional accuracy in signal conditioning and voltage division circuits. With a ±50ppm/°C temperature coefficient, it delivers stable performance across a wide operating range of -70°C to +125°C, making it suitable for environments with thermal fluctuations. The 1W total power rating (0.05W per resistor) and 100V maximum voltage rating provide robust handling of moderate power loads. Its gull-wing termination ensures reliable solderability in automated PCB assembly processes.
GUS-QS0B-02-4020-DD Features
- Precision Thin Film Technology: Offers low noise and high stability for sensitive analog/digital circuits.
- Compact QSOP Package: Measures 8.66mm (L) × 6.02mm (D) × 1.47mm (H) with tight tolerances (±0.1mm height/length), ideal for space-constrained designs.
- High Power Density: 1W total dissipation (distributed across 19 resistors) outperforms similar networks in power handling.
- Wide Temperature Range: Operates reliably from -70°C to +125°C with derated power at elevated temperatures.
- Automated Assembly Optimized: 0.64mm terminal pitch and gull-wing leads ensure compatibility with pick-and-place systems.
- Non-Automotive/Non-PPAP: Suitable for industrial, telecom, and instrumentation applications where PPAP compliance is not required.
